Palindrome?

A numerical palindrome has the same value when all of its digits are reversed.

The number e3c23 is not a palindrome.

A Prime Number

A prime number is a positive integer that is divisible only by itself and one.

Seven thousand four hundred and eighty-seven is the 948th prime number.   See primes in Base 23 Trivigesimal

Not A Composite

Composites have more than just these two factors.

Seven Thousand Four Hundred and Eighty-Seven is not a composite number because it has exactly two factors: One and Seven Thousand Four Hundred and Eighty-Seven
